Thank you British Council Nidhi Singal for this important opportunity for us to work with teachers with disabilities across 5 countries. Their reflections have deeply enriched our reflections on promoting inclusion in mainstream education, and the systemic complexities involved.
We often see reports about children and teachers but rarely about teachers with disabilities. This new report by Prof Nidhi Singal , Dr Thilanka Wijesinghe and Dr Patricia Kwok addresses just that.

Our study on school segregation in South Africa has now been published Social Forces. Using school census data and a new visual method (segplot) we show that both racial and socioeconomic segregation are exceptionally high. ⬇️academic.oup.com/sf/advance-art… 1/n
